Venia Dimitrakopoulou's Futuro Primordiale at Museo Salinas in Palermo

exhibition · 2026-05-04

Venia Dimitrakopoulou, an artist from Athens, presents a wide selection of sculptures, papers, and installations at the Museo Archeologico Regionale Antonino Salinas in Palermo, some shown for the first time in Italy. The exhibition, titled Futuro Primordiale – Materia, is curated by Matteo Pacini and Afrodite Oikonomidou. It continues the dialogue between contemporary art and the archaeological museum initiated last June with Evgeny Antufiev's solo show. The works, including masks and lances in stone and bronze, are integrated into the museum's display, erasing temporal and conceptual distances. The exhibition is part of a trilogy that will continue at the Fondazione Sandretto Re Rebaudengo in Turin (February 22 – March 31, 2019) and at the Civico Museo Sartorio and Castello di San Giusto in Trieste (April 12 – June 14, 2019).
